在CSS中,我們可以使用display屬性來控制元素的顯示方式,當我們想要隱藏某個元素時,可以將其display屬性設置為none。
display: none;
使用上面的代碼可以將元素隱藏,但是這并不是最好的方式。如果我們需要動態的顯示和隱藏元素,建議是使用visibility屬性。
visibility: hidden;
上面的代碼可以將元素隱藏,但是會保留元素原來的位置。當我們需要顯示元素時,可以將visibility屬性設置為visible。
visibility: visible;
還有一種方式可以隱藏元素,是通過將元素的opacity屬性設置為0。但是這種方式只是將元素變成透明,元素仍然占據原來的位置。
opacity: 0;
在使用以上三種方式隱藏元素時,需要注意的是它們的影響范圍。如果我們只是想要隱藏元素內部的某部分內容,應該在需要隱藏的內容外再嵌套一個元素,并將其使用以上的方式隱藏。
最后,需要注意的是,使用以上方式隱藏元素只是隱藏了元素的外觀,但是元素仍然存在于DOM結構中。如果我們需要徹底地將元素從頁面中移除,應該使用JavaScript操作DOM。